1970’s Terraced House in Rahoon

Location:

Rahoon

Home Type:

Terraced house built in approximately 1978

Tenants:

Mother and son

Retrofit Project Goals:

The goal for this retrofit was to reduce energy bills whilst contributing to sustainability.

This conscious working family had concerns about the environment and wanted to do their bit to help.

Retrofit Project Summary:

Una approached us with a terrace house that was difficult and costly to keep warm. After an initial assessment, we identified key improvements that could be undertaken including installing high-performance wall insulation and upgrading to a more efficient heating system.

The main factors affecting her energy bills and BER rating were poor insulation, inefficient windows and doors, and an outdated heating system.

The approximate cost of the home energy upgrade was €5,219, and we helped the homeowner access €850 in grants and funding to support the retrofit.

Retrofit Enhancements:

  • Wall Insulation
  • Heating System Upgrade

Home Energy Upgrade Results:

  • Access to €850 in grants and funding for the home energy upgrade
  • The initial BER Rating of C3 has now been improved to C2
  • A projected reduced use of fossil fuels and electricity during the winter
